Subject: Regional sales review — actions

Heads of department,

Northvale and Serrow regions missed Q2 targets; Dunmire exceeded by 9%. Review complete. Actions: consolidate the Serrow territory under one lead, freeze non-essential travel, and shift two account managers to Dunmire. Revised forecasts due Friday, no extensions. Underperformance drivers are documented in the shared tracker. Strategic implications are covered in the confidential note below.

— Elwin

management briefing: Project Ulavan slips by two quarters because of the staffing delay.

## Ticket: Config drift breaking trace propagation

Heads up, support folks — traces through the Fernmark services are coming out fragmented again. Root cause is config drift: the order service got a sampler update last sprint but the cart and payments services didn't, so trace headers get dropped mid-request. Customers reporting "missing order history" are likely hitting this. Until the rollout finishes, verify affected services against the expected tracing configuration below.

settings of kageg-yawig:
[casix]
host = casix.tolvaqlabs.corp
user = casix_svc
database = casix_prod

Fan-out backpressure for the Quillet notifier: when the queue depth crosses the soft limit, the dispatcher sheds low-priority pushes and batches the rest at 500ms intervals. Reviewer should confirm the shed counter is exported and that retries respect the jitter window. Once merged, the release artifact gets re-signed by the pipeline, which expects the deploy key shown below.

deploy key for bawep-yawif: bky6_GQhaSt